Master Roblox Simulator Scripting to Dominate the Front Page

Creative Living Hub image

Unlocking the Power of Roblox Simulator Scripting

Roblox simulator games are among the most popular genres on the platform, attracting millions daily. The scripting behind these games is the engine that drives player engagement and longevity.

Understanding how to script effectively in Roblox simulators is essential for developers aiming to attract attention. Mastery of scripting mechanics directly impacts a game’s visibility and user retention.

Why Simulator Scripting Stands Out

Simulator games often replicate real-world or fantasy systems, requiring intricate scripting to create immersive experiences. These scripts control everything from player interactions to in-game economies, making them complex yet rewarding to design.

This complexity is precisely what makes simulator scripting a skill in high demand. Developers who excel in this area produce games that consistently climb the ranks.

Key Elements That Push Simulator Games to Popularity

Several core scripting components influence whether a simulator game gains traction on Roblox’s front page. These elements include performance optimization, user interface responsiveness, and rewarding gameplay loops.

Optimizing these factors requires both efficient code and an understanding of player psychology. A well-scripted game that resonates with its audience is inevitable for success.

Performance Optimization in Simulator Scripting

Efficient scripts reduce lag and prevent crashes, critical for maintaining player interest. Optimization involves minimizing unnecessary loops and managing resource-heavy processes smartly.

Leveraging Roblox’s built-in functions along with custom code helps maintain smooth gameplay. Developers who fail to optimize often see user drop-off rates increase significantly.

Designing Responsive User Interfaces

User interfaces scripted to respond instantly to player actions enhance immersion. Smooth UI animations and feedback mechanisms contribute to user satisfaction.

Incorporating event-driven scripting models ensures the interface reacts only when necessary, preserving system resources. This approach also aligns with Roblox’s best scripting practices.

Advanced Scripting Techniques for Simulator Success

Beyond basics, advanced scripting methods unlock new possibilities for simulator developers. Techniques such as data persistence, server-client communication, and procedural content generation elevate game quality.

Utilizing these tools differentiates average simulators from those that captivate audiences and climb the charts.

Implementing Data Persistence

Data persistence ensures player progress is saved seamlessly across sessions. Scripts using Roblox DataStores maintain inventories, currency, and achievements reliably.

Robust error handling within these scripts prevents data loss, enhancing trust and long-term engagement. Skilled use of persistence scripting is a hallmark of top-tier simulators.

Optimizing Server-Client Communication

Effective communication between server and client scripts synchronizes gameplay accurately across multiple players. This coordination is vital for multiplayer simulator games.

RemoteEvents and RemoteFunctions are standard tools developers use to facilitate these interactions. Mastery over these APIs is indispensable for creating dynamic, responsive simulators.

Procedural Content Generation in Simulators

Generating game content dynamically through scripts provides unique player experiences. This approach keeps gameplay fresh and increases replayability.

Procedural scripting can create environments, challenges, or rewards that adapt to player progression. Implementing it requires strong algorithmic skills and an understanding of game design principles.

Measuring and Leveraging Player Data to Refine Games

Analyzing player behavior data collected through scripts informs meaningful improvements. Heatmaps, session lengths, and event triggers reveal patterns about player engagement.

Incorporating analytics scripts enables developers to identify pain points and optimize accordingly. Data-driven decision-making is a powerful strategy to maintain front-page status.

Key Metrics to Track with Scripts

Scripts can track metrics such as daily active users, average session duration, and in-game economy flows. These provide insight into overall game health and player satisfaction.

Using this information, developers adjust difficulty curves, balance rewards, and update content to sustain interest. Regular monitoring ensures that changes produce the desired effects.

Essential Tools and Resources for Roblox Simulator Scripting

Several tools complement Roblox Studio for efficient scripting and testing. Plugins, debugging utilities, and community libraries accelerate development workflows.

Harnessing these resources optimizes both script quality and development speed, crucial for competitive simulator creation.

Popular Scripting Plugins

Plugins like Rojo, Moon Animator, and ScriptWare enhance coding, animation, and debugging. These tools integrate seamlessly with Roblox Studio for efficient scripting.

Using such plugins reduces errors and speeds delivery, enabling rapid iteration cycles. Top developers routinely use these tools to maintain high standards.

Community Script Libraries

Open-source script libraries provide reusable modules for common simulator functions such as currency systems and inventory management. Access to these reduces development time significantly.

Exploring repositories on GitHub or Roblox developer forums uncovers valuable codebases. Adapting proven scripts ensures reliability and performance.

Analyzing Front-Page Simulator Games as Case Studies

Examining scripts from successful Roblox simulators offers valuable insights into effective techniques. Many popular games feature well-structured, modular code tailored for scalability.

These games utilize balanced reward systems and intuitive controls implemented through clean scripting architectures. Studying these examples helps identify best practices to emulate.

Game Scripting Highlight Player Engagement Feature Optimization Strategy
Pet Simulator X Advanced data persistence Dynamic pet evolution Efficient event handling
Bee Swarm Simulator Procedural quest generation Reward multipliers Load balancing scripts
Mining Simulator Server-client sync Inventory management Optimized UI scripting

Leveraging lessons from these titles in your own scripts enhances both quality and popularity potential. Replicating techniques proven to engage users is a strategic advantage.

Marketing and Updating Your Simulator Game

Regular updates scripted to introduce fresh content maintain player interest over time. Announcing these through social channels boosts visibility and encourages return visits.

Combining well-crafted scripts with savvy marketing ensures your simulator reaches and sustains front-page ranking. Persistent engagement is the foundation of Roblox success.

Scheduling Scripted Content Updates

Implementing update scripts that unlock new features or events at regular intervals keeps players invested. Automation of these scripts can simplify release cycles.

Players respond positively to consistent novelty, leading to higher retention and word-of-mouth promotion. Planning scripted updates is essential for ongoing growth.

Integrating Social Features through Scripting

Scripts enabling friend leaderboards, gifting, and cooperative mechanics foster community building. Social interaction is a major driver of simulator popularity.

Incorporating social API calls within your scripts multiplies engagement opportunities. Games that connect players socially often dominate Roblox’s trending lists.